How to prepare for a job interview at ASDA
✨Know the Company
Before your interview, take some time to research the retail company. Understand their values, mission, and what makes them stand out in the market.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
✨Showcase Your Team Spirit
Since the role involves working in a team, be prepared to discuss your experiences collaborating with others. Share specific examples of how you've contributed to a team environment in the past, whether it was through problem-solving or supporting colleagues during busy times.
✨Demonstrate Your Customer Service Skills
As a Customer Service Colleague, you'll be interacting with customers regularly. Think of scenarios where you've provided excellent service or resolved issues effectively. Highlight these experiences during your interview to illustrate your friendly demeanor and ability to handle customer queries.
✨Prepare Questions
At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or the company's approach to customer service.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
